Game-Changing Tips
Professional Insights
To elevate your homemade date caramel, use high-quality Medjool dates. These dates are naturally sweet and have a rich flavor that enhances your caramel. Ensure they are fresh for the best results.
Expert Techniques
Always soak your dates if they're firm. This softening step is crucial for achieving a smooth consistency. Use a high-speed blender or food processor to ensure there are no lumps.
Kitchen Wisdom
For added creaminess, consider incorporating coconut oil into the blend. It not only enhances texture but also adds a subtle coconut flavor that pairs beautifully with dates.
Success Guarantees
Taste as you go! Adjust sweetness by adding more dates if desired or balance flavors with spices like cinnamon or nutmeg until it meets your preferences.

Storage & Make-Ahead
Storage Guidelines
Store your date caramel in an airtight container in the refrigerator to keep it fresh longer—up to two weeks!
Preservation Methods
If you want it to last even longer, consider freezing portions in ice cube trays before transferring them into freezer bags once frozen solid.
Reheating Instructions
When ready to use frozen date caramel, thaw overnight in the fridge or warm gently in the microwave until it's spreadable again.
Freshness Tips
Always check for signs of spoilage before using stored date caramel; avoid consuming if there's any off smell or discoloration present.

Expert FAQ Solutions
Common Concerns
Many worry about grainy textures when blending; rest assured soaking helps achieve smoothness! Always blend adequately until creamy consistency forms without lumps left behind.
Expert Answers
If you're unsure how thick should be ideal? Aim for pourable yet slightly sticky texture—similar thickness found within traditional store-bought caramels will yield fantastic results here too!
Troubleshooting Guide
If mixture seems too runny after blending? Simply add more pitted dates gradually until desired thickness achieved—blend thoroughly each time before checking consistency again afterwards!

⚖️ Ingredients:
- 1 cup Medjool dates, pitted (about 10-12 dates)
- 1/4 cup almond milk (or any plant-based milk)
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- Pinch of sea salt
- (Optional) Add-ins: 1 tablespoon coconut oil, a sprinkle of cinnamon or nutmeg
🥄 Instructions:
- Step 1: [Step 1] If your Medjool dates are not soft, soak them in warm water for about 10 minutes to soften. Drain before using.
- Step 2: [Step 2] In a high-speed blender or food processor, combine the softened dates, almond milk, vanilla extract, and sea salt.
- Step 3: [Step 3] Blend until smooth and creamy. If the mixture is too thick, add more almond milk one tablespoon at a time until desired consistency is reached.
- Step 4: [Step 4] Taste your date caramel; if desired, add optional coconut oil for richness or spices like cinnamon/nutmeg to enhance flavor.
- Step 5: [Step 5] Blend again until fully incorporated.
- Step 6: [Step 6] Transfer the date caramel into an airtight container.
- Step 7: [Step 7] Store in the refrigerator for up to two weeks.
